How does Paine support his idea that there is “no country on the globe” as “capable of raising a fleet as America”?
Ymorist [56]

Answer:

Thomas Paine supports his idea that there is "no country on the globe" as capable of raising a fleet as America" by saying; see explanation

Explanation:

Thomas Paine supports this idea by saying that timber, tar, iron and cardage are America's natural produce, therefore America don't need to import any of that. But that the Dutch who makes profits by hiring out their ships of war to the Spaniards and  Portuguese, imports most of the materials they use.

Thomas Pain used his persuasive ability in his pamphlet 'Common Sense" to present ideas that will make Americans fight for political independence from the Great Britain. He succeeded in convincing many Americans including George Washington to seek redress.
